Home Correspondent Can You Establish a Delaware LLC Without Residing in Delaware-

Can You Establish a Delaware LLC Without Residing in Delaware-

by liuqiyue

Can I open an LLC in Delaware without living there?

Delaware has long been the go-to state for forming Limited Liability Companies (LLCs) due to its favorable business laws, tax advantages, and a well-established legal system. Many entrepreneurs are attracted to the idea of establishing an LLC in Delaware, even if they do not reside in the state. In this article, we will explore the feasibility of opening an LLC in Delaware without living there, and the steps involved in the process.

Understanding the LLC Structure

Before diving into the specifics of forming an LLC in Delaware, it is essential to understand the structure of an LLC. An LLC is a business entity that combines the limited liability protection of a corporation with the flexibility and tax benefits of a partnership. This means that the owners (members) of the LLC are not personally liable for the company’s debts and obligations.

Can You Open an LLC in Delaware Without Living There?

Yes, you can open an LLC in Delaware without living there. The state of Delaware does not require LLC members or managers to be residents of the state. This makes it an attractive option for entrepreneurs who want to establish a business presence in Delaware, regardless of their location.

Steps to Form an LLC in Delaware

1. Choose a Name: The first step in forming an LLC is to choose a unique name that complies with Delaware’s naming requirements. The name must contain the words “Limited Liability Company,” “Limited,” or “LLC” and cannot be deceptively similar to any existing business names in Delaware.

2. File Articles of Organization: Once you have chosen a name, you will need to file Articles of Organization with the Delaware Division of Corporations. This document will include the LLC’s name, address, and the names and addresses of its members and managers.

3. Appoint a Registered Agent: A registered agent is a person or entity authorized to receive legal documents on behalf of the LLC. While you can act as your own registered agent, many entrepreneurs choose to hire a professional registered agent service to ensure they are always available to receive important correspondence.

4. Draft an Operating Agreement: An Operating Agreement is a legally binding document that outlines the internal structure and governance of the LLC. While not required by Delaware law, it is highly recommended to have an Operating Agreement in place to avoid potential disputes among members.

5. Pay Filing Fees: The filing fee for forming an LLC in Delaware is $90. Additionally, there may be other fees associated with the process, such as the registered agent fee and the annual franchise tax.

6. Maintain Compliance: Once your LLC is formed, it is essential to maintain compliance with Delaware’s ongoing requirements. This includes paying the annual franchise tax and keeping your registered agent informed of any changes to your LLC’s contact information.

Conclusion

Opening an LLC in Delaware without living there is not only possible but also a common practice for many entrepreneurs. By following the outlined steps and understanding the legal requirements, you can establish a Delaware LLC that can operate nationwide or internationally. Remember to consult with a legal professional or business formation service to ensure your LLC is properly set up and maintained.

Related Articles